Where marketing automation projects stall

Most marketing automation projects don't fail on the technology. They fail on one of these five things:

  • Reporting automation gets sold on the demo client, then breaks on your messiest account — the one with three ad platforms, two attribution models, and a client who wants a custom KPI; confirm the vendor has automated reporting for an account as messy as your worst one, not your best one
  • Brand voice training needs real samples and real client sign-off — an AI that drifts off-brand on client-facing copy costs you the account, so treat the training period as non-negotiable, not a shortcut
  • Campaign-setup automation without a QA checkpoint before launch risks a live campaign with the wrong budget cap or audience — insist on a human-approval gate before anything goes live, not after
  • Multi-platform data pulls (Google Ads, Meta, GA4, plus whatever niche tool a client insists on) trip up generic connectors — ask for proof the vendor has built custom pulls beyond the big three, not just an API checkbox
  • The strategist who set up the reporting templates and audience logic leaves, and the undocumented rules leave with them — insist on documented, portable logic, not a black box

What actually automates, and what doesn't

Not every task inside a role automates at the same rate. Data pulls, reporting narratives, and campaign-structure cloning — the bulk of a reporting analyst's or campaign manager's day — automate to 90%+ once the AI has trained on your brand voice and templates. What determines your results

These ranges are wide on purpose — where you land depends on three things: how many platforms and custom KPIs your reporting has to reconcile (a straightforward Google Ads-plus-Meta account sees faster payback than one juggling five data sources), your client count (higher volume amortizes the fixed setup cost faster), and how much of your campaign work is genuinely repeatable versus fully custom per client.

What weeks 1-4 actually look like

"30 days" hides a lot of variance. For an agency with a handful of clients on Google Ads and Meta with clean historical reports, 30 days end-to-end is realistic. Larger client rosters, custom KPIs, or niche platforms beyond the big three push it to 6 weeks — be skeptical of any vendor who quotes 30 days flat without first looking at your messiest account. Here's what each stage actually involves:

1
Week 1 Discovery

Audit your messiest client account first, map every data source that feeds a report, flag any custom KPIs or attribution models that need special handling

2
Week 2 Build

Connect to Google Ads, Meta, GA4, and any client-specific tools; train reporting narrative and campaign templates on your brand voice and past client work

3
Week 2-3 Shadow

AI generates reports and campaign drafts in parallel with your team for 5-10 business days; PMs review every output against their own judgment before anything reaches a client

4
Week 3-4 Go Live

Full automation for reporting and campaign setup with a human-approval gate before launch, strategist time reallocated to client strategy and account growth

Budget internal time, too — most vendors won't mention this part. Expect your point person (usually a senior strategist or ops lead) to spend 4-6 hours a week during weeks 1-3 reviewing reporting narratives and campaign templates. That drops to under an hour a week once you're live and reviewing exceptions only.

What to evaluate in any vendor

Whether you go with Leverwork or anyone else, these are the five questions that separate a real automation partner from a demo that falls apart on your actual client roster:

  • Can they show it working on a messy account? A demo on a single-platform client tells you nothing — ask for proof on an account with multiple ad platforms and custom KPIs.
  • Is there a human-approval gate before anything goes live? Campaign setup and client-facing copy need review before launch or send, not after.
  • How is brand voice trained, and who approves it? Ask what happens when the AI drifts off-brand on a client account, and how fast that gets corrected.
  • Does it integrate beyond the big three platforms? "Connects to your marketing stack" is generic — ask for proof they've built custom pulls for niche or client-specific tools.
  • What happens to your templates and rules if you cancel? You should be able to export reporting templates and campaign logic, not just historical data.
